Ave Maria: CCSO Territory
Ave Maria is a master-planned unincorporated college town in eastern Collier County. There is no city police; the Collier County Sheriff's Office (CCSO) provides law enforcement. All arrests transport to the Naples Jail Center, about 45 minutes west.
Address: 3347 Tamiami Trail East, Naples, FL 34112
Circuit: 20th Judicial Circuit (Lee + Charlotte + Collier + Hendry + Glades)
Ave Maria University
Ave Maria University is a private Catholic university at the center of the town. The university has its own campus security, but CCSO handles off-campus incidents and criminal arrests. The student population generates occasional enforcement related to noise and alcohol.
Eastern Collier Isolation
Ave Maria's location in eastern Collier County near the Florida Panther National Wildlife Refuge means it is relatively isolated. The long transport time to the Naples jail delays the booking process. CCSO maintains a substation in the town center for dedicated coverage.

Collier County Clerk
The Collier County Clerk at (239) 252-2646 handles case lookups. The 20th Circuit covers five counties. The Collier County Courthouse at 3315 Tamiami Trail East in Naples handles criminal proceedings.

Florida Bail Bond Protections
- 10% maximum premium — F.S. 648.44.
- Written contract required before payment.
- 21-day collateral return — F.S. 648.442.
- DFS complaints: 1-877-693-5236.
